Share via


dispinterface

Coloca una interfaz en el archivo .idl como interfaz de envío.

[dispinterface]

Comentarios

Cuando el atributo de dispinterface C++ precede a una interfaz, hace que la interfaz se coloque dentro del bloque de la biblioteca en el archivo generado .idl.

A menos que se especifique una clase base, una interfaz de envío derivará de IDispatch.Debe especificar ID para los miembros de una interfaz de envío.

El ejemplo para dispinterface en la documentación de MIDL:

dispinterface helloPro 
   { interface hello; }; 

no es válido para el atributo de dispinterface .

Ejemplo

Vea el ejemplo para enlazable para obtener un ejemplo de cómo utilizar dispinterface.

Requisitos

Contexto de atributo

Se aplica a

interface

repetible

No

Atributos necesarios

None

Atributos no válidos

dual, objeto, oleautomation, local, ms_union

Para obtener más información, vea Contextos de atributo.

Vea también

Referencia

uuid (atributos de C++)

dual

personalizada (C++)

objeto (C++)

__interface

Otros recursos

Atributos IDL

Atributos por Uso

Attributes Samples